Output f6955e0c0c8a175ab8a61c074ba0774f4f31109a2ea10aec44a01ee9facfa366:9

value
182300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ecbbe3d1c69c4860ec3fbd0d9469647e5921cfa OP_EQUAL
address
34VrGcqxn4ZJQ6WmbQwNaXBoBGAh8FUehX
transaction
f6955e0c0c8a175ab8a61c074ba0774f4f31109a2ea10aec44a01ee9facfa366
confirmations
132147
spent
true